Job Summary

Morgan Lewis & Bockius LLP one of the worlds leading global law firms with offices in strategic hubs of commerce law and government across North America Asia Europe and the Middle East is seeking to hire a Senior Paralegal for the Litigation Practice group reporting to the Manager of Legal Practice Support and will be responsible for providing project assistance and case management to attorneys and trial teams as follows.

This position will reside in our Seattle office and offers a flexible hybrid in-office/remote working arrangement which allows for you to work 2 days remotely and 3 days collaboratively in the office.

General Litigation Responsibilities:

  • Document and database maintenance including managing and overseeing electronic data document collections from internal and external clients; searching collected data; recommending and refining searches when appropriate; analyzing data as required using computer assisted review technologies; communicating with data custodians and requesters as necessary; collaborating with external vendors and other internal IT groups.

  • The review and preparation of documents reports and correspondence.

  • Assisting with discovery requests and productions including Bates labeling documents organizing the production in Firm applications creating a document production log.

  • Assisting with drafting proofing editing and filing court filings (state and federal) using eFile systems.

  • Knowledge of Subpoena preparation and service of process.

  • Cite-checking and Bluebooking briefs memorandum white papers etc.

  • Creating tables of authority and tables of contents for court filings.

  • Tracking and communicating case related dates and information.

  • Ensure that all events/deadlines are properly calendared with the Calendaring Department.

  • Assist with witness preparation direct examination cross-examination binders/folders for depositions and trial.

  • Assembling and tracking deposition hearing and trial exhibits.

Experience/Qualifications:

  • A bachelors degree from an accredited college or university.

  • A minimum of 5-7 years of litigation paralegal experience.

  • The ability to handle the multiple responsibilities of case management and trial preparation in a fast-paced team environment; must be detail oriented and work error-free.

  • Knowledge of MS Office including Outlook Word Excel Kofax PDF and iManage is a plus.

  • Familiarity with local state and federal rules of procedure.

  • Understanding of litigation support systems including Case Notebook Relativity ClientSite strongly desired.

  • Legal research skills desired.

  • Proofreading and editing skills strongly desired.

  • Excellent oral and written communication skills are important.

  • The flexibility to work overtime as needed to meet deadlines is desired.

  • Prior paralegal experience in a litigation environment is highly desired
